Summary

This agreement is an indenture dated June 1, 2000, between LADCO Financial Group (as Servicer), LADCO Funding Corp. VII (as Issuer), and Norwest Bank Minnesota (as Indenture Trustee and Back-up Servicer). It governs the issuance of equipment lease-backed notes, outlining the roles and responsibilities of each party, the terms for issuing and managing the notes, and the procedures for handling defaults, payments, and trust administration. The agreement also details the rights of noteholders and the process for financing additional lease receivables.

Section 6.08 Application of Money Collected. If the Notes have been declared due and payable following an Event of Default and such declaration has not been rescinded or annulled, any money collected by the Indenture Trustee with respect to the Notes pursuant to this Article Six or otherwise and any other money that may be held thereafter by the Indenture Trustee as security for the Notes shall be applied in the following order, at the date or dates fixed by the Indenture Trustee and, in case of the distribution of such money on account of principal or interest, upon presentation of the Notes and the notation thereon of the payment if only partially paid and upon surrender thereof if fully paid. FIRST: All amounts due and owing and required to be distributed to the Indenture Trustee, the Back-up Servicer, and any successor Servicer, respectively, pursuant to priorities (ii), (iii) and (xii) of Section 11.02(d) hereof and not previously distributed, in the order of such priorities and without preference or priority of any kind within such priorities; SECOND: If LFG is the Servicer, to the payment of the Servicing Fee then due the Servicer hereunder and under the Servicing Agreement and to pay the Servicer the amount necessary to reimburse 45 the Servicer for any unrecovered Servicer Advances to the extent that Scheduled Payments or other Recoveries are collected on the related Lease Contract; THIRD: To pay to the applicable Swap Providers, if any, the regularly scheduled payments specified in each confirmation (as such terms is defined in the applicable Swap Agreement) entered into pursuant to all Swap Agreements then in effect but not including any breakage or other termination costs incurred thereunder; FOURTH: To the payment to the Noteholders of then accrued and unpaid Note Interest Charges, with interest (to the extent such interest has been collected by the Indenture Trustee or a sum sufficient therefor has been so collected and payment thereof is legally enforceable at the respective rate or rates prescribed therefor in the Notes) on overdue interest; FIFTH: To the payment to the Noteholders of the remaining Outstanding Principal Balance; SIXTH: To the payment to the Noteholders or their designated agents, pro rata, for (a) any costs or expenses incurred in connection with any enforcement action with respect to this Indenture or the Notes and (b) Carrying Costs not reimbursed above; SEVENTH: To the payment to the Swap Provider of any other amounts due and owing under any applicable Swap Agreement; EIGHTH: If LFG is the Servicer, any other amounts due it as Servicer as expressly provided herein and in the Servicing Agreement; NINTH: To the payment of any surplus to or at the written direction of the Issuer or any other Person legally entitled thereto. Section 11.02 Collection Account; Redemption Account. (a) Prior to the Closing Date, the Indenture Trustee shall open and maintain a segregated trust account in the name of the Indenture Trustee at its Corporate Trust Office (the "Collection Account") for the benefit of the Noteholders, for the receipt of (i) Lease Receivable Collections and Loss and Damage Waiver Fees, (ii) Fundings made by Noteholders pursuant to Sections 3.05, (iii) amounts received pursuant to any Swap Agreement, and (iv) any Reinvestment Income and other amounts, if any, remitted by the Issuer pursuant to Section 11.02(c). Funds in the Collection Account shall not be commingled with any other monies. All payments to be made from time to time by the Issuer to the Noteholders out of funds in the Collection Account pursuant to this Indenture shall be made by the Indenture Trustee or the Paying Agent. All monies deposited from time to time in the Collection Account pursuant to this Indenture shall be held by the Indenture Trustee as part of the Trust Estate as herein provided. (b) Upon Issuer Order, the Indenture Trustee shall invest the funds in the Collection Account in Eligible Investments. The Issuer Order shall specify the Eligible Investments in which the Indenture Trustee shall invest, shall state that the same are Eligible Investments and shall further specify the percentage of funds to be invested in each Eligible Investment. No such Eligible Investment shall mature later than the Business Day preceding the next following Payment Date and shall not be sold or disposed of prior to its maturity. In the absence of an Issuer Order, the Indenture Trustee shall invest funds in the Collection Account in Eligible Investments described in clause (g) of the definition thereof. Eligible Investments shall be made in the name of the Indenture Trustee for the benefit of the Noteholders. The Indenture Trustee shall provide to the Servicer monthly in its monthly statement confirmation of such investments, describing the Eligible Investments in which such amounts have been invested. (c) Any income or other gain from investments in Eligible Investments as outlined in (b) above shall be credited to the Collection Account and any loss resulting from such investments shall be remitted by 72 the Issuer to the Indenture Trustee for deposit into the Collection Account as incurred. The Indenture Trustee shall not be liable for any loss incurred on any funds invested in Eligible Investments pursuant to the provisions of this Section 11.02 (other than losses from nonpayment of investments in obligations of Norwest Bank Minnesota, National Association issued in its capacity other than as Indenture Trustee). (d) On each Payment Date if either no Default or no Event of Default shall have occurred and be continuing or a Default or Event of Default shall have occurred and be continuing but the entire Outstanding Principal Balance of all Notes shall not have been declared due and payable pursuant to Section 6.02, then no later than 12:00 p.m. (New York time) on such Payment Date, after making all transfers and deposits to the Collection Account pursuant to Section 11.02(a), the Indenture Trustee shall withdraw from the Collection Account from funds received during or with respect to the related Collection Period amounts sufficient to make the following disbursements, and shall make such disbursements in the following order in accordance with the provisions of and instructions on the Monthly Servicing Report; provided that the Indenture Trustee shall withdraw from the Collection Account and make interest and principal payments on the Notes even if it shall not have received the Monthly Servicing Report and, upon receipt of the Monthly Servicer Report, or such other information as may be required by the Indenture Trustee, shall pay each such other amounts set forth below, all as set forth in the Monthly Servicing Report or in such other information delivered to the Indenture Trustee: (i) to pay to the Servicer (A) the Servicing Fee then due, (B) any Servicing Charges inadvertently deposited into the Collection Account, (C) Reinvestment Income, (D) any unreimbursed Servicer Advances to the extent that the corresponding Scheduled Payments or other Recoveries were received and (E) any amounts constituting sales or property taxes collected and inadvertently deposited into the Collection Account; (ii) to pay to the Indenture Trustee (A) the Trustee Fee then due and (B) any out-of-pocket expenses (including reasonable attorney fees) incurred by it, which expenses shall not exceed $200,000 on a cumulative basis (it being understood that the Indenture Trustee shall not be obligated to incur expenses except as otherwise provided in Section 7.01(c)(iii) and 7.03(e) hereof); (iii) to the Back-up Servicer the Back-up Servicer Fee then due, any Transition Costs incurred by it and, if it has become the successor Servicer, any Additional Servicing Fee then due; (iv) to pay to the applicable Swap Providers, if any, the regularly scheduled payments specified in each confirmation (as such terms is defined in the applicable Swap Agreement) entered into pursuant to the Swap Agreements then in effect (but not including any breakage or other termination costs incurred thereunder); (v) to pay to the Noteholders all Note Interest Charges then due on that Payment Date and any previously accrued and unpaid Note Interest Charges; (vi) to pay to the Administrator an amount equal to the Administrative Fee and Unused Fee due on such Payment Date, including amounts previously accrued but remaining unpaid; (vii) to pay to the Noteholders an amount equal to the Principal Distribution Amount, if any; 73 (viii) during the Accumulation Period, to retain in the Collection Account for reinvestment on subsequent Funding Dates an amount equal to 75% of any remaining Lease Receivable Collections (or such greater percentage as is specified in the Monthly Servicing Report as necessary to cause the Overcollateralization Amount to equal or exceed the Minimum Overcollateralization Amount); (ix) to pay to the Administrator an amount equal to all other Carrying Costs accrued but unpaid as of such Payment Date; (x) to pay to the Noteholders during the occurrence and continuation of a Rapid Amortization Event, an amount equal to the Additional Principal Distribution Amount; (xi) to pay to the Swap Provider any other amounts due and owing under any applicable Swap Agreement; (xii) to reimburse the Indenture Trustee, the Back-up Servicer, and any successor Servicer any other amounts due them under any of the Transaction Documents and not previously reimbursed above or otherwise under the Transaction Documents; (xiii) to reimburse the Servicer any other amounts due it under any of the Transaction Documents; (xiv) to pay the remainder to or on the order of the Issuer.
